GOME-2 Instrument

Measurements and Applications

Measurement of total column amounts and stratospheric and tropospheric profiles of ozone. Also amounts of H20, NO2, OClO, BrO, SO2 and HCHO.

Performance Summary

Resolution
Horizontal: 40 x 40 km (960 km swath) to 40 x 5 km (for polarization monitoring)
[Best Resolution: 5000m]
Swath
120 - 960 km
[Max Swath: 960 km]
Accuracy
Cloud top height: 1 km (rms), Outgoing short wave radiation and solar irradiance: 5 W/m2, Trace gas profile: 10 - 20%, Specific humidity profile: 10 - 50 g/kg
Waveband
UV - NIR: 0.24 - 0.79 µm (resolution 0.2 - 0.4 nm)
